texte = The code is not broken though. The site and code this error was reported from has been working in production without incident since 2004!Other errors reported before we restarted WebCat were exactly what Karl Scholl reported in a post earlier today:"random site database that can't be found, or a template is reported missing, and sometimes the path to the template is missing a / between the directory and the template name"And, some sites on the same server work fine???Restarting fixed all this, but it makes me crazy that I cannot pinpoint why this happened. We have not developed any new WebCatalog sites for over a year.
